 Research Assistant Ezginaz Kara Presented Her Master's Thesis as a Paper at an International Symposium


Ezginaz Kara, a research assistant at the Department of Interior Architecture and Environmental Design at Istanbul Gelisim University, presented her master’s thesis as a conference paper on June 27, 2025, at the 7th SIAP International Symposium on Innovation in Architecture, Planning and Design.


Her paper, titled “The Impact of Biophilic Design Elements on User Experience: The Case of Maçka Park in Şişli District, Istanbul”, explored the contribution of natural elements to user experience in urban open spaces. In her study, Kara evaluated the psychological and environmental effects of biophilic design, emphasizing its role in shaping users’ spatial perception. The presentation highlighted the importance of nature-integrated design approaches in urban life. The findings pointed to the necessity of increasing the use of biophilic elements in environmental design practices.
